The vineyard has been owned by the family of Count Lafond since the end of the 18th century, which also owned the largest and most famous vineyards in the Pouilly region, where it was called Château du Nozet. The whole estate covers over 165 hectares and is responsible for the production of 10% of the wines of the entire Pouilly Fumé appellation. Since its inception, the most outstanding Sauvignon Blanc wines have been produced here.
In 1972, the whole was taken over by Baron Patrick de Ladoucette, who pays great attention to the variety of wines produced in each of his estates, in order to best reflect their character. Suffice it to say that thanks to this, the wines of de Ladoucette are considered among the best representatives of the main wine regions in France, for years famous for their high quality.
Baron de L Pouilly-Fumé de Ladoucette
A wonderful Sauvignon Blanc, one of the few known for its ageing potential. After the fermentation process, it matures on the lees for 8 to 10 months in glass tanks with a ceramic coating. The next maturation period is up to 15 months on fine lees. On the nose it is very aromatic, yet elegant and subdued, citrus and lemongrass are combined with notes of acacia and orange. On the palate it is very smooth and perfectly complex, gracefully combining notes of citrus freshness with accents of blood oranges and white peaches. The finish is long and majestic with a remaining pleasant acidity and a slightly mineral accent.
It tastes best served at a temperature of 10-12 degrees. Perfect for drinking alone, as well as an exquisite aperitif, in culinary combinations it works well with light appetizers, seafood, and dishes with the addition of nuts and flowers.
